Odyssey Elementary School is
a public school
in Everett, Washington that is part of Mukilteo School District.
It serves 500 students
in K - 5
with a student/teacher ratio of 13.9:1.
Its teachers have had 147 projects funded on Ðǿմ«Ã½.
